Minutes — Management Meeting, Ralsten Instruments

Present: all division leads. Apologies: none.

1. Revised commission scheme approved for rollout in the Verath territory first; tiered rates replace flat percentage.
2. Clawback period extended to two quarters.
3. Payroll to model transition costs by month-end.
4. Communication to reps deferred until board sign-off. The confidential note below summarises the strategic rationale for the board.

internal memo for kawip-hadug: Headcount on the Wenwyn team goes from 7 to 140 by the end of January. Gross margin on Wenwyn came in at 20 percent against a plan of 15 percent.

## Releases

Sketchloom's undo/redo stack is the riskiest surface in the editor, so every release runs the full history-replay suite before tagging. A release bundles the command-log schema version; if you change how undo entries are serialized, bump the schema and add a migration. Contractors cut release candidates from `main` only, never feature branches. Tag the build, run the replay suite, then sign the release artifact with the key below.

signing key of bagap-yawep = bky13_TbfT6ZMUoGJo2

Handover: bulk edits in the Ferrowick admin table. Selection state is stored per-page, so "select all" only covers visible rows — intentional, see the June design doc. The batch mutation endpoint validates each row independently and returns partial failures; the UI must surface these, not swallow them. Please route any review questions on this module to:

approver of bagug-bagag = Holael Pramir

**Audit item 14 — Cold storage archival.** Verify all Frostvault buckets older than 180 days are moved to the Glacierline archive tier. Check lifecycle rules on the parkeet-raw and parkeet-derived buckets; two were missing rules last cycle. Confirm restore test passed this quarter. Flag any bucket over 5 TB without a tagged owner. The accountable engineer for sign-off this week is listed below.

account owner for kafop-haweg: Pelax Gilael Istir